Time is an irreplaceable resource. Once it is lost, it is forever gone. If you work at home, you need to decide how you can best spend the time in your hands. This article offers some tips that can help you manage your time so you can make the most out of every hour you spend at work.
First, set goals. Know what you want to accomplish so you will know where to direct your efforts. Goals help you focus and keep you on the right track. Your goals will also guide your priorities. Your goals need to be measurable so you will know how well you are doing and they should be time-bound so you will know how to schedule your activities.
Make a list of the tasks that need to be done for the day. This may seem like a no-brainer to some people, but it is crucial. Be realistic and don't make your list too long or else you will feel overwhelmed. Keep your list short and simple. Next, prioritize the tasks on your list. Do the most difficult tasks first. They require a lot of your energy and you are likely do them well when you are not yet tired. When you have done accomplished the difficult tasks, everything else will seem easy to do.
Divide your time in "blocks." You don't have to work continuously for hours. You know the length of your attention span. If you think you'll be most productive when you work in 30-minute blocks, go ahead. If you think you'll do better with one-hour blocks, then work for a full hour before taking a break. Take 10 to 15-minute breaks between work blocks so that you will feel rested and recharged when you get back to work.
Set your working hours. Working at home offers you flexibility in setting your working hours, but that doesn't mean that you don't need a schedule. When it's time to call it a day, stop working. Remember, balance is essential and there is more to life than work. Pat yourself on the back for a job well done.
